Nigerian music sensation Adekunle Gold was in the stands as Manchester United defeated Tottenham 2-0 at Old Trafford.

AG had seen a couple of Man Utd games, but the Red Devils have lost those matches; however, Wednesday’s encounter was totally different.

After the first half had ended goalless, Fred put United ahead in the 47th minute and then Bruno Fernandes sealed the win with another fine strike in the 69th minute as United won the tie 2-0.

After the game, Adekunle Gold took to his Instagram handle to laud the club as he also stated that he had finally broken the jinx.

He said:

"Today, I broke the curse. AG baby has finally ended his streak of Man Utd losing every time he goes to see them play at Old Trafford. Hallelujah."

Man Utd fans once told AG to avoid Old Trafford

Meanwhile, the popular singer was once told to stay away from Old Trafford as this came after Manchester United’s FA Cup loss last season.

He was part of the spectators at the stadium to watch the Red Devils trade tackles with Championship club Middlesbrough in the FA Cup fifth round.

Adekunle Gold, in a video posted on Twitter, was seen in a great mood watching the penalty shootout, but that changed in a flash as Manchester United suffered an embarrassing 8-7 loss to Middlesbrough.

After the match ended, the video posted by @UnclePamilerin went viral on social media as he asked the singer to stay away from Old Trafford.

Woli Agba and Lateef Adedimeji spotted at Old Trafford

Sports Brief earlier reported that Nigerian celebrities Woli Agba and Lateef Adedimeji recently visited Old Trafford, the home ground of English Premier League club Manchester United.

Woli Agba, a comedian, was excited to visit the historic stadium and quickly took to his social media accounts to share his photos and videos on the Red Devils' turf.

Old Trafford is a football stadium in Greater Manchester. With a capacity of 74,310, it is the largest club football stadium in the United Kingdom and the eleventh-largest in Europe.
